Transaction 3bbdb71a24abcbf82c3396934c3f3d7ca769956fc809deac7bdbd9063a09e1ca

1 Input
2 Outputs
  • 3bbdb71a24abcbf82c3396934c3f3d7ca769956fc809deac7bdbd9063a09e1ca:0
  • value  180981
    address  1DzzzzaZtP8rXeoQ3pKk8ZnrfR5eTwHmza
  • 3bbdb71a24abcbf82c3396934c3f3d7ca769956fc809deac7bdbd9063a09e1ca:1
  • value  1182627
    address  366BZTsjZws8kktMCSzgXiWBEcMcW8uUmr